erreur de doctype

WRInaute discret
Je suis une dame de 45 ans et j'ai des problèmes avec mon code html. Je pense que c'est pour cette raison qu'aucun moteur de recherche ne me voit. Pourriez vous m'aider? Quand je fais un test de pages c'est l'horreur.
Merci a tous.
Pascale
 
WRInaute discret
Merci a tous !!
§ le premier élément n'est pas une spécification DOCTYPE?? quand je fais un test htlm j'ai cette erreur et aussi plein de ALT manquant dans me photos !!! est ce grave docteur ????

Pourquoi acheter aussi le nom enchere-facile ! petite explication svp et je le fais de suite ! dois-je denouveau faire un referencement avec se deuxième nom ?? j'ai aussi acheté encheresfaciles ???

Le nouveau google ?? pourriez vous m'expliquer.
Merci bcp d'une presque mamy !! :D
 
WRInaute occasionnel
erreur sur votre page

Bonjour à vous.
Pour moi, déja, revoir vos url
a href="../../Mes%20Documents/Mes%20sites%20Web/encherefacile/acheter.htm
a href="esemple%20annonce.htm
nouveau%20petit%20bouton.gif
a href="pays.htm#nous
a href="formulaire%20de%20mise%20en%20vente.htm

Evitez les espaces dans les url remplacer par _

André :lol:
 
WRInaute discret
mon site est en ligne depuis un mois ! je sais que je dois attendre mais je veux m'assurer que je n'attends pas pour rien. Je suis déjà tres contente de la frequentation ! :D
 
WRInaute impliqué
Les "alt" manquants servent à afficher une infobulle au survol des photos mais ils servent surtout à faire apparaitre vos photos pour les recherches d'images (sur Google).

A ce propos, j'ai un site comprenant une quantité de photos et aucune n'est indexée par Google. J'ai pourtant bien utilisé "alt" et mes vignettes ne sont pas cliquables puisque le lien pour les agrandir est en texte (je crois savoir que Google n'aime pas les vignettes cliquables).

Une solution ?

Merci d'avance,
Loïc.
 
WRInaute occasionnel
lien acheter

Non, il faut modifié le lien
<a href="../../Mes%20Documents/Mes%20sites%20Web/encherefacile/acheter.htm">
ca c'est le chemin vers ton dossier à modifier par "acheter.htm"

Bonne journée

André :wink:
 
WRInaute passionné
Bonjour Loltina,

Pour éviter les soucis lors du transfert de pages sur un serveur, il faut suivre quelques règles simples en matière de nommage de fichiers et répertoires.

1. Pas de caractères propres à notre bonne vieille langue française (accents, cédilles...)

2. Pas d'espace dans les noms.
Contrairement à Windows ou MacOS, les serveurs Linux n'aiment pas cela du tout et c'est source d'erreurs. Les espaces sont d'ailleurs remplacées par des %20 lors de l'encodage de l'URL et cela finit par avoir mauvaise allure dans la barre d'adresses du navigateur.
Il vaut mieux remplacer les espaces par un tiret (-) ou un caractère de soulignement (_).
Le tiret est considéré par Google comme séparateur de mot. Pour le soulignement, les avis sont partagés... donc, dans le doute, utilise le tiret. Il a de plus l'avantage de rester visible si tout le texte est souligné, comme dans un lien par exemple.

3. Tant qu'à faire, essaye d'éviter les majuscules.
La raison en est simple:
Windows ne fait pas la différence entre majuscules et minuscules mais Linux considère cela comme des caractères différents.
Un lien image qui pointe vers "monimage.gif" alors que le fichier s'appelle "MonImage.gif" sera valide sur ton serveur local au moment de la création de la page. Une fois ta page sur le serveur, le fichier "monimage.gif" ne sera pas trouvé (à cause des majuscules/minuscules) et te donnera une case avec la petite croix rouge correspondant aux images manquante. Pas du meilleur effet...

Cordialement,

Dan
 
WRInaute passionné
Suite...

La déclaration !DOCTYPE n'a pas qu'une utilité pour les validateurs de pages.
Selon le type de document déclaré, certains navigateurs pourront se mettre automatiquement en mode "strict" , "standard" ou "quirks", et changer l'allure de la page.
C'est le cas pour Internet Explorer, Mozilla, Opera et la majorité des navigateurs récents. Tu trouveras plein d'articles sur le sujet, je te suggère de commencer par celui-ci (en français): http://www.la-grange.net/accessibilite/day_6.html

Une fois le !DOCTYPE défini , il est toujours préférable de passer ses pages par un validateur HTML et de coller aux normes autant que faire se peut.
Pas par simple plaisir toutefois: les moteurs de recherche ont des robots d'indexation qui sont construits selon les normes W3C. Il est assez facile d'imaginer que lorsqu'ils visitent une page répondant aux mêmes normes, ils n'auront aucun problème de compréhension pour cette page... et pourront donc l'indexer au mieux !

Dan

<édité l'URL>
 
WRInaute discret
Merci bcp pour toutes vos réponsses! Pas facile d'être seule devant son PC et c'est bien agréable de trouver de l'aide.
 
WRInaute passionné
loltina a dit:
Merci bcp pour toutes vos réponsses! Pas facile d'être seule devant son PC et c'est bien agréable de trouver de l'aide.
Pas de quoi ! N'hésite pas à poster ici si tu coinces devant ton clavier.
Et puis, dis-toi que 45 ans ne représentent toujours que 1420092000 secondes!
Il y a sur ce forum plusieurs membres qui en ont déjà vu passer quelques dizaines/centaines de millions de plus (dont moi! :roll: )

A+

Dan

PS: on devrait lancer un concours pour savoir qui est le vétéran du forum, j'aurais peut-être la chance de gagner quelque chose, pour une fois :lol:
 
Olivier Duffez (admin)
Membre du personnel
hetzeld a dit:
PS: on devrait lancer un concours pour savoir qui est le vétéran du forum, j'aurais peut-être la chance de gagner quelque chose, pour une fois :lol:
D'accord, mais il faut pouvoir prouver son âge... Ce n'est pas en chantant que tu vas nous convaincre ?
 
WRInaute passionné
Je ne me suis jamais engagé à chanter! Tout cela sort de l'imagination délirante de deux "groupies de service" : Sidonie et Marie ! 8)
 
WRInaute passionné
Bonsoir loltina,

Pour le doctype, l'écriture correcte est
Code: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
En ajoutant cette URL, tu indiques avec précision aux navigateurs la "grammaire" sur laquelle ils doivent se baser. Cela évite les erreurs dont parle Dan.

Et si tu ajoutes ceci dans tes meta
Code:
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
tu peux utiliser normalement et sans problème les accents, cédilles ou autres caractères spéciaux (le code est quand même plus facile à relire).

Amicalement,
Monique
 
WRInaute discret
Voilà se que j'ai mis !

<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
Un avis SVP?
 
WRInaute passionné
WRInaute occasionnel
Monique a dit:
Dans la plupart des cas, ton site s'affichera sans.

Dans IE6, ne pas mettre l'URL aura pour effet de désactivé le mode 'Standards-compliant'
( cf: http://msdn.microsoft.com/library/defau ... ements.asp )

Dans une logique de bonne indexation dans les moteurs, je pense que le respect des standards dans leur intégralité est le seul moyen de garantir que les spider comprennent le code HTML qu'il leur est fourni.

Mirgolth,
Très fier d'être 100% valide XHTML1.1 !
 
WRInaute passionné
Bonjour Mirgolth,

Tu as tout à fait raison, simplement, comme loltina utilse le transitional, elle court un peu moins de risque.
Je suis moins aussi une ardente défenseure (m'énerve les mots impossibles à mettre au féminin :evil:) du respect des standards comme de l'accessibilité pour tous.
La nouvelle version de mon site sera validée en html 4.01 strict... pas encore assez sûr de moi pour aborder le xhtml :(

Amicalement,
Monique
 
WRInaute passionné
Bravo à Monique et Mirgolth , avec une mention spéciale du jury pour Mirgolth, car ce n'est pas facile.
Je suis aussi "validé 4.01 strict" et suis convaincu que ce ne peut être que bénéfique au référencement.

Je lisais pas plus tard qu'hier un article où un responsable de Google était interrogé sur ce sujet. Sa réponse était, de mémoire : "nous avons développés nos robots pour qu'ils soient à même de s'accomoder du plus grand nombre possible d'erreurs html".
Ce qui m'a percuté dans cette phrase c'est "le plus grand nombre d'erreurs" qui ne veut pas dire "toutes les erreurs".
Donc, si un site ne valide pas, on ne pourra jamais être certain que les erreurs ne sont pas bloquantes pour les robots.

Comme on dit en anglais: "better safe than sorry" :wink:

Dan
 
WRInaute passionné
Monique a dit:
Je suis moins aussi une ardente défenseure (m'énerve les mots impossibles à mettre au féminin :evil:) du respect des standards comme de l'accessibilité pour tous.
Donc tu n'es sûrement pas professeur ? Ministre ou juge peut-être ? :lol:
 
WRInaute discret
au secours

Hier j'ai mis sur toutes mes pages
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">



Aujourd'hui j'ai ajouté via le blocnote le http et quand je vais voir mon code je n'ai plus rien disparu!!!!!!!!!! J'ai sauvegardé, ben rien !!

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
"http://www.w3.org/TR/html4/loose.dtd">
 
WRInaute occasionnel
hetzeld a dit:
Je lisais pas plus tard qu'hier un article où un responsable de Google était interrogé sur ce sujet. Sa réponse était, de mémoire : "nous avons développés nos robots pour qu'ils soient à même de s'accomoder du plus grand nombre possible d'erreurs html".
Ce qui m'a percuté dans cette phrase c'est "le plus grand nombre d'erreurs" qui ne veut pas dire "toutes les erreurs".

Il faut aussi penser au fait que Google n'a pas (encore) 100% des parts de marché. Il y a une multitude d'autres robots qui peuvent être amenés a passer sur votre site.
Et si vos pages font pleurer de désespoir le validateur du W3C, alors il se peut que le code de vos pages passe pour du baragouin incompréhensible aux yeux des robots.

Rassurez-vous, il existe un vaccin. Celui-ci doit être administré à vie pour éviter toutes rechutes. Néanmoins, tous les spécialistes s'accordent pour louer les bénéfices du traitement.

Pour finir, si on vous donne 80 euros, vous ne direz probablement pas non. Et s'il vous suffisait de mieux parler pour gagner 20 euros de plus, vous refuseriez ?

Jocelyn
 
WRInaute passionné
hetzeld a dit:
Monique a dit:
Je suis moins aussi une ardente défenseure (m'énerve les mots impossibles à mettre au féminin :evil:) du respect des standards comme de l'accessibilité pour tous.
Donc tu n'es sûrement pas professeur ? Ministre ou juge peut-être ? :lol:

C'est vrai, Dan... mais "de mon temps", à l'école, on apprenait professeur nom masculin, défenseur nom masculin... :roll:
Résultat, c'est plus fort que moi, écrire une défenseur me hérisse, et dire un défenseur à propos de moi me semble inadapté :lol:

Amicalement,
Monique
PS : merci pour tes encouragemnts :)
 
WRInaute passionné
Re: au secours

loltina a dit:
Aujourd'hui j'ai ajouté via le blocnote le http et quand je vais voir mon code je n'ai plus rien disparu!!!!!!!!!! J'ai sauvegardé, ben rien !!

Que veux-tu dire par là ? Qu'est-ce qui a disparu ?
Quel éditeur utilises-tu pour créer tes pages ?

Ce ne sont que des questions, mais je ne comprends pas ce qui t'es arrivé :?

Amicalement,
Monique
 
WRInaute discret
je m'explique comme pour mon site j'utilise frontpge :( je dois tout modifier par le blocnote et quand j'ai ajouté le http etc...... pour le doctype il a disparu alors que j' avais tout sauvegardé! j'ai toujours <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"> mais pas avev http etc....
Merci Monique ( mon amie qui a 62 ans et qui travaille avec moi pour le site s'apelle aussi monique :wink: )
 
Discussions similaires
Haut